Dr Tanaya Narendra, also called Dr Cuterus, not too long ago shared an uncommon treatment on a podcast. “A really efficient manner of coping with any form of ache, not simply interval ache, is gaali dena. Humare paas research hain jo dikhati hain ki agar do teams banaye jayein, to jis group ko gaali dena allowed hai, woh zyada der tak ache maintain kar sakta hai,” Dr Tanaya mentioned. (Cursing helps in relieving any form of ache, together with interval ache. There are research to assist this. Should you divide a gaggle into two and considered one of them is allowed to curse, they’ll maintain ache stimuli for longer.)
She additional referred to Keele College’s 2009 examine, led by psychologist Dr Richard Stephens, during which two teams had been requested to immerse their arms in ice-cold water. The group that was allowed to curse may maintain the ache for 30 seconds longer. Dr Tanaya defined that since they had been in a position to vent their aggression by phrases, their ache tolerance elevated.

Taking a cue from Dr Tanaya’s suggestion, we reached out to Neha Parashar, scientific psychologist at Mindtalk, to confirm if this hack really works.
Is it true that swearing in periods may help relieve cramps?
“Swearing prompts the limbic system, the a part of the mind concerned in emotion and stress responses. This activation triggers the discharge of adrenaline and endorphins, that are the physique’s pure painkillers,” Parashar tells us whereas explaining the physiological motive.
Swearing can create a way of launch and emotional validation, serving to an individual really feel extra accountable for their menstrual ache expertise (picture supply: pexels)
“Psychologically, swearing can create a way of launch and emotional validation, serving to an individual really feel extra accountable for their expertise. This mixture of emotional catharsis and neurochemical modifications can momentarily uninteresting ache notion,” she provides.
Though just a few research counsel a correlation between swearing and ache aid, Parashar cautions that the proof is restricted and never particularly centered on menstrual ache, and thus shouldn’t be taken as an alternative to medical therapy.Story continues beneath this advert
How do feelings and stress have an effect on interval ache?
Parashar explains that stress and powerful feelings can worsen interval ache by growing cortisol ranges within the physique. “Elevated stress hormones can heighten sensitivity to ache and result in muscle pressure, which aggravates cramps.”
Moreover, anxiousness and low temper can alter the way in which the mind processes ache alerts, making discomfort really feel extra intense. For this reason leisure, emotional assist, and stress administration are key to managing menstrual well being.
How else can ladies maintain themselves throughout their intervals?
To cut back the severity of cramps, Parashar suggests practices comparable to common bodily exercise, light stretching or yoga, sufficient hydration, balanced meals wealthy in iron and magnesium, and constant sleep. “Warmth remedy, like utilizing a scorching water bag on the decrease stomach, and mindfulness strategies comparable to deep respiration or meditation, are additionally efficient.”
Nonetheless, Parashar emphasises that if ache is extreme or disrupts every day life, consulting a gynaecologist or psychologist for tailor-made therapy is essential.Story continues beneath this advert
